For me, the question begs -- what is lost?
A cell may have life, but not consciousness. The cell may develop consciousness -- this is really about potential.
What is lost for the cell, if removed from the possibility of gestation, is the potential for consciousness.
What is lost for the carrier for gestation is the cells with a potential for consciousness -- and whatever emotional attachment she may have to that (if any).
Then the next question is what is the level of harm here, as this would define the moral import.
